EPL: Chelsea beat Man City 2-1

Marcos Alonso fired in an injury time winner for Chelsea after Sergio Aguero fluffed a penalty as Chelsea delayed Manchester City’s Premier League title party with a dramatic 2-1 victory at the Etihad.

After Raheem Sterling gave the hosts the lead, Aguero was made to look very silly by Edouard Mendy after his Panenka fell easily into the hands of the Blues goalkeeper shortly before half-time.

Ziyech then grabbed a deserved equaliser for Thomas Tuchel’s men, who will meet Pep Guardiola’s side in the Champions League final on May 29.

Alonso then fired in a winner with seconds left to play after some good play down the left from Timo Werner.

The defeat means Man City were not officially crowned champions on Saturday, but a draw or defeat for second-placed Manchester United against Aston Villa on Sunday will cement their name as champions.
